Scoff has very kindly offered to show the ins and outs of his side-mount system designed for cave diving. Some of us are very familiar with the dir style system for open water and the larger caves. This is a great chance to see the system evolved for smaller caves.
Capernwray is a handy venue, poor dark vis, and other divers kicking your head to simulate contact with the cave roof :-)
I would love to meet up, have a chat, and see and have a go with a properly put together harness----a few post dive beers are always good too!
Does anyone else fancy it-----Scoff has asked for a few dates.
I would be game for 22nd November, 29th November, 6th December----or at present, any time in January or February, plus practically any Tuesday.

This follows on from the thread on helmets on the dir page.

Cheers all, Malcolm.
